Today marks the 80th anniversary of the end of World War II, as Japan’s surrender in 1945 brought a close to the global conflict that lasted six years. A special ceremony is being held at the National Memorial Arboretum to commemorate this milestone, attended by around 30 veterans who served in the Far East during the war.

With only a few surviving veterans from that era, this anniversary holds particular significance in honoring their sacrifices.
